How to Host an Outdoor Fire Pit NYE Celebration

Creating the Perfect Atmosphere

As the year comes to a close, many of us look for ways to celebrate with friends and family. An outdoor fire pit celebration can be a magical way to welcome the New Year. Imagine cozying up by the warm glow of a crackling fire, surrounded by twinkling lights and the sounds of laughter. To create the perfect atmosphere, start by selecting a cozy outdoor space. Decorate with string lights, lanterns, and plenty of comfortable seating to ensure your guests feel at home.

Essential Fire Pit Setup

Setting up your fire pit is crucial for a successful evening. Make sure to choose a safe location, away from flammable materials, and ensure it’s well-ventilated. Gather all necessary supplies, including firewood, kindling, and a fire starter. For an added touch, consider providing blankets for your guests to snuggle up with as they enjoy the warmth. Don’t forget to set up a s'mores station with graham crackers, marshmallows, and chocolate. This delightful treat will surely evoke the spirit of Christmas and bring back fond memories for everyone.

Festive Food and Drinks

No celebration is complete without delicious food and drinks. For an outdoor fire pit gathering, keep your menu simple yet festive. Think hearty appetizers like cheese boards, stuffed mushrooms, or seasonal dips that guests can nibble on throughout the evening. As for drinks, consider a hot chocolate bar complete with toppings like whipped cream, peppermint sticks, and marshmallows. For the adults, mulled wine or spiked cider can add a warm, festive touch. These tasty treats will not only satisfy appetites but also enhance the overall holiday ambiance.

Fun Activities to Keep the Spirit Alive

To keep spirits high as the clock counts down to midnight, plan some engaging activities. Consider organizing a fun trivia game centered around Christmas traditions or a karaoke session featuring everyone’s favorite holiday songs. You can also encourage guests to share their New Year’s resolutions or fondest Christmas memories around the fire. These activities will not only entertain but also foster connections among your guests, making your celebration unforgettable.

As the night progresses, gather everyone around the fire to share stories and count down to the New Year together. The warmth of the fire, combined with good company and festive cheer, will create a memorable experience that celebrates both the end of the year and the spirit of Christmas.
